最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
编程开发入门:智能化工具助力编程小白快速上手
在当今数字化时代,编程已经成为一项必备技能。无论是为了职业发展,还是个人兴趣,掌握编程语言和开发工具都是至关重要的。然而,对于许多初学者来说,编程的复杂性和技术门槛常常让人望而却步。幸运的是,随着人工智能技术的发展,新一代智能编程工具如雨后春笋般涌现,大大降低了编程的难度。本文将探讨如何借助智能化工具开启编程之旅,并重点介绍一款极具创新性的开发环境——它不仅让编程变得简单易懂,还能帮助新手迅速提升编程能力。
1. 智能化工具如何改变编程学习体验
传统的编程学习通常需要从基础语法开始,逐步掌握各种概念和技术。这种学习方式虽然扎实,但对于没有编程背景的人来说,可能会显得枯燥且耗时。智能化工具通过引入自然语言处理(NLP)和机器学习算法,使编程变得更加直观和互动。用户可以通过简单的对话与工具交流,快速生成代码、修改项目并解决问题。这种方式不仅提高了学习效率,还增强了用户的自信心。
2. 应用场景:轻松实现项目开发
想象一下,你是一个刚刚接触编程的学生,面对一个复杂的作业任务——比如开发一个图书借阅系统。在过去,这可能意味着你需要花费大量时间查阅资料、调试代码,甚至有时还会因为一个小错误而卡住。但现在,有了智能化工具的帮助,这一切都变得简单多了。例如,在HNU的一次大作业挑战中,学生们使用了一款名为InsCode AI IDE的工具,成功攻克了图书借阅系统的开发难题。这款工具内置了AI对话框,允许用户通过自然语言描述需求,AI会自动生成相应的代码片段,帮助学生快速完成任务。不仅如此,AI还能提供实时的代码补全、注释添加、单元测试生成等功能,确保项目的高质量完成。
3. 实战演示:从零开始创建游戏
为了让读者更直观地了解智能化工具的强大功能,我们可以通过一个具体的案例来展示其应用过程。假设你想开发一个贪吃蛇小游戏,但对编程一窍不通。借助InsCode AI IDE,你可以轻松实现这一目标。首先,打开AI对话框,输入“我想创建一个贪吃蛇游戏”,接下来按照提示逐步完善游戏逻辑。AI会根据你的描述,自动为你生成游戏的基本框架,并提供必要的代码片段。如果你遇到问题,只需将错误信息告诉AI,它会立即给出修改建议。整个过程中,你无需具备深厚的编程知识,只需要专注于创意和设计,就能快速搭建出一个功能齐全的小型游戏。
4. 提升效率:优化代码与性能分析
除了简化代码编写过程,智能化工具还能够帮助开发者优化现有代码。以InsCode AI IDE为例,它不仅支持全局代码生成和改写,还可以对代码进行深度分析,找出潜在的性能瓶颈并提出优化方案。这对于那些希望提高代码质量和运行效率的开发者来说尤为重要。例如,在开发一个Web应用时,AI可以自动识别出哪些部分需要改进,从而减少不必要的资源消耗。此外,AI还能为代码生成详细的注释,方便团队成员理解和维护。
5. 社区支持与生态建设
作为一款由优快云、GitCode和华为云CodeArts IDE联合开发的产品,InsCode AI IDE不仅拥有强大的功能,还得到了广泛的社区支持。开发者可以在官方论坛上交流经验、分享插件,共同推动平台的发展。同时,Open VSX插件生态也为用户提供了丰富的扩展选择,满足不同场景下的个性化需求。无论你是编程新手还是资深工程师,都能在这个充满活力的社区中找到属于自己的位置。
6. 结语:开启智能编程新时代
综上所述,智能化工具正在彻底改变编程的学习和工作方式。它们不仅降低了入门门槛,还提升了开发效率和代码质量。对于广大编程爱好者而言,选择一款合适的智能编程工具至关重要。InsCode AI IDE以其高效便捷的操作体验、强大的AI辅助功能以及完善的社区支持,成为了众多开发者心目中的首选。如果你也想体验这种全新的编程模式,不妨下载试用一下吧!相信你会感受到前所未有的便捷与乐趣。
下载链接:点击这里下载InsCode AI IDE
了解更多:访问官方网站获取更多信息和支持。
通过这篇文章,我们希望能够激发更多人对编程的兴趣,并引导他们利用先进的智能化工具踏上编程之路。愿每一位读者都能在这个充满无限可能的新时代中找到属于自己的舞台。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考